Description:
- Develop and implement individualized and small-group instruction aligned with students IEP goals, state standards, and district curriculum.
- Create a safe, supportive, and inclusive learning environment that promotes student growth, independence, and self-advocacy.
- Monitor student progress through ongoing assessment, data collection, and progress reporting, adjusting instruction and interventions as needed.
- Utilize evidence-based instructional strategies, assistive technology, and differentiated materials to meet diverse learning needs.
- Collaborate with general education teachers, related service providers, families, and administrators to support student achievement and successful inclusion.
- Implement positive behavior support strategies and maintain a structured classroom environment that fosters student engagement and success.
- Participate in IEP meetings, professional development activities, and school events as required.
- Qualified Candidates must have a valid CT Certification in the area which they apply.
